Output 143c74285bf68b35d5452d51739700c6f215bd2c19734a44ee104391d8e6472d:0

value
42808792
script pubkey
OP_0 OP_PUSHBYTES_20 d3502164678f24222edd9a7550fc25f9012ebbc2
address
ltc1q6dgzzer83ujzytkanf64plp9lyqjaw7zppfpcf
transaction
143c74285bf68b35d5452d51739700c6f215bd2c19734a44ee104391d8e6472d
spent
true